Discover more about Mirador de Taraccasa

Mirador de Taraccasa is a captivating ecological park situated in the picturesque region of Abancay. This enchanting destination is renowned for its stunning panoramic views, where visitors can admire the majestic landscapes that characterize the Andean region. The park is enveloped in lush greenery, offering a tranquil retreat for nature enthusiasts and those seeking solace in the great outdoors. As you explore the park's winding trails, you'll encounter a rich tapestry of flora and fauna, showcasing the unique biodiversity that thrives in this area. The gentle sounds of birds chirping and the rustling of leaves create a soothing atmosphere, inviting you to immerse yourself in nature's embrace. For many tourists, Mirador de Taraccasa serves as an ideal spot to capture unforgettable photographs, especially during sunrise or sunset when the skies are painted with vibrant hues. Moreover, the park is an excellent location for picnics, allowing families and friends to gather and enjoy a meal surrounded by nature. The well-maintained paths cater to all visitors, making it accessible for those of varying fitness levels. Whether you are looking for a peaceful walk, a place to meditate, or simply a scenic backdrop for your vacation memories, Mirador de Taraccasa delivers on all fronts.     Getting There

    Car

    If you are traveling by car, start from Abancay city center. Head northwest on Av. San Martín toward Av. José de la Riva Agüero. Continue on this road until you reach the intersection with Av. La Paz. Turn left on Av. La Paz and follow it until you reach the junction with the road that leads to the Mirador de Taraccasa. Follow the signs towards the viewpoint. The journey should take around 30 minutes depending on traffic.

    Public Transportation

    To reach Mirador de Taraccasa via public transport, take a taxi from Abancay to the viewpoint. Taxis are readily available in the city, and the fare may cost around 20-30 soles, depending on negotiation. Make sure to confirm the price before starting your journey. The taxi ride typically takes about 30 minutes. If you are on a budget, you can ask the taxi driver about shared rides with others going to the same destination.

    Hiking

    For the more adventurous, you can hike to Mirador de Taraccasa once you reach the nearest accessible point by car or taxi. Ensure you have a good map or GPS to guide you. The hiking route can be steep and may take an additional 1-2 hours depending on your pace and the trail conditions.
